Job Description: We are looking for a construction project manager candidate to join our dynamic team in the metal framing and drywall division in our Southern California (Los Angeles) location.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ing projects from start to finish, ensuring they are completed on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ards. This is a challenging and rewarding role that offers excellent growth opportunities for the right candidate.
Responsibilities:
Manage all aspects of construction projects, including budget, schedule, quality control, safety, and team coordination.
Coordinate with clients, architects, engineers, and subcontractors to ensure project requirements are met.
Prepare and maintain project schedules, budgets, and progress reports.
Conduct site visits to ensure work is progressing according to schedule and quality standards.
Identify and mitigate project risks and proactively communicate with the project team.
Develop and maintain strong relationships with clients, suppliers, and subcontractors.
Manage project closeout and ensure all required documentation is completed and submitted on time.
Be a team player
Requirements:
Bachelor’s degree in construction management, engineering, or related field.
Minimum of 3 years of experience in construction project management tasks, with a focus on metal framing and drywall.
General knowledge of construction codes and safety standards
Excellent organizational skills
Excellent communication, leadership, and team management skills.
Proficiency in basic project management software and Microsoft Office Suite.
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
Wage Scale: Between $80,000 and $120,000 depending on education and experience.
